When I removed my Targa top, I found a nifty GSL badge and lots of un-faded paint. You can get at the screws after you open both doors, a few run up the sills. More screws along the back of the roof where the hatch meets the top. Should be a few pieces of double sided tape along the front edge of the top.

i've got a targa band and the rear spoiler. i'm missing the front spoiler. together the pieces make up an appearance package that mazda called the "IMSA" appearance package. the parts could be purchased seperatly or as the IMSA package.
